About this office
- Taking over if the governor leaves office
- Running the state senate's sessions, in many states
- Breaking tie votes in the state senate, in many states

Candidates
Democratic · declared
Esther Charlestin is a Democratic candidate for Lieutenant Governor of Vermont in 2026. She chairs the Vermont Commission on Women and was the Democratic nominee for governor in 2024.
Republican · Incumbent · declared
John Rodgers is the Republican Lieutenant Governor of Vermont, in office since 2025, and is running for re-election in 2026. He previously served as a Vermont state senator.
Democratic · declared
Molly Gray is a Democratic candidate for Lieutenant Governor of Vermont in 2026. She previously served as Lieutenant Governor of Vermont (2021-2023) and is an attorney and former assistant attorney general.
